**Q: How do I rerun the catalogue import for the Fennick Library system?**

A: The Fennick importer processes MARC batches nightly; a failed batch is quarantined, not retried automatically. Before re-queuing, confirm the source export from Larchview completed and that no schema migration is pending in the release window. Re-queue only whole batches, never individual records. If the importer reports duplicate accession numbers, escalate to the catalogue platform team at the address below.

escalation mailbox, yajeg-bageg: quenax.olidor@lumiccorp.internal

# Parity notes for support: the Quillbright SDKs (Sparrow for mobile,
# Heron for desktop) are feature-matched as of release 4.2, except
# Heron still lacks offline sync retries. If a customer reports a
# method missing on Sparrow, check the parity matrix before escalating.
# Both SDKs read this env file at startup, so keep keys identical
# across installs. The shared session secret belongs on the very next line.

sealed setting: VAULT_KEY20=c8ea1e419912889df6b4

**Changelog — Reportly v4.2**

Heads up, support folks: we renamed `EXPORT_TZ_MODE` to `REPORT_EXPORT_TIMEZONE` because nobody could remember what "mode" meant. Exports now default to the workspace timezone instead of UTC, so fewer "my report is off by six hours" tickets. Old configs still work until v5. The export worker also needs its signing credential set in the env file, like so:

secret setting of yagef-baweg: RELAY_SECRET29=cb53deb59a49ed54d9f43599b54ca

Issue: Castlark feed validator rejects feeds with HTTP 502 during enclosure checks.

The validator fetches each enclosure head-first; upstream hosts that block HEAD requests trigger a retry storm and eventual 502. Mitigation: enable the fallback_get flag per feed, which issues a ranged GET instead. Note that fallback requests are rate-limited to two per second and logged for audit. To reproduce against the staging validator, call the diagnostics endpoint authenticated with the bearer token below.

bearer token for tawig-bahif: eyJhbGciOiJIUzI1NiIsInR5cCI6IkpXVCJ9.eyJzdWIiOiIo-yiO33jvEIn0.T9qLInSAqhTN